Spectra by Stephen West Published in westknits Craft Knitting Category Neck / Torso → Scarf Published June 2011 Suggested yarn Noro Silk Garden Sock madelinetosh Tosh Merino Light Yarn weight Fingering / 4 ply (14 wpi) ? Gauge 22 stitches and 44 rows = 4 inchesin Garter Stitch Needle size US 5 - 3.75 mm Yardage 640 - 650 yards (585 - 594 m) Sizes available One Size Spectra is a simple lightweight scarf featuring two fingering weight yarns. Short row shaping creates a dramatically curved edge that coils and playfully drapes. Basic intarsia technique entwines two strands of yarn, creating seamless wedges that resemble a rainbow or color wheel. You won’t want to stop knitting as the colors unfold! Finished Measurements: 72″ / 183cm along shorter garter stitch edge, 6.5″ / 16.5cm wide. Measurements taken after blocking. Yarn: Fingering weight Color A (Madelinetosh): 420 yds / 384m Color B (Silk Garden Sock): 230 yds / 210m

SSP is worked flat (sideways), increasing along one edge to create an asymmetrical triangle. Stitches are increased in the slip stitch pattern and then onward into the 1x1 ribbing. A built-in slip stitch edge and the slip stitch colorwork (you only work with one color on any given row) will be the perfect introduction into colorwork (promise - you will have nothing but fun!). The combination of easy slip stitch patterns and the sportive wide ribbing give this shawl a sophisticated yet casual look. The pattern includes additional instructions for a slightly different version (two colors only, larger size) Yarn heavy fingering to light DK weight yarn, approximately C1: 325 yds (297 m) C2: 255 yds (233 m) C3: 68 yds (65 m) C4: 205 yds (187 m) C5: 166 yds (152 m) C6: 113 yds (103 m) modified version: C1: 744 yds (680 m) C2: 624 yds (570 m) sample shown in C1: The Plucky Knitter Yakkity in color Old Mill (mid grey) - BT Loft in color sweatshirt would be a good substitute ;) C2: BT Loft in color Camper (rose) C3: BT Loft in color Fossil (white) C4: BT Loft in color Hayloft (mustard) C5: BT Loft in color Snowbound (light grey) C6: BT Loft in color Faded Quilt (blue) it is possible to use C1 where C5 is used. Needles US 4 (3.5 mm) circular needle, 40” (100 cm) long, or size needed to get gauge needle size is a recommendation only, please make a gauge swatch to determine the size needed to get gauge Gauge (after blocking) Stockinette stitch: 22 sts x 30 rows = 4” (10 cm) Slip stitch pattern 1: 22 sts x 31 rows = 4” (10 cm) Slip stitch pattern 2: 22 sts x 35 rows = 4” (10 cm) Slip stitch pattern 3: 22 sts x 48 rows = 4” (10 cm) To swatch the different pattern stitches it is recommended to cast on 26 sts and work at least 4 repeats of slip stitch pattern 1 and 8 repeats each of slip stitch pattern 2 & 3. Gauge is not crucial for this project but will affect yardage and final size when different. Finished measurements Approximately 77.5” (197 cm) wingspan, 57.75” (146.5 cm) long and 47.25” (120 cm) wide. modified version: Approximately 91.25” (232 cm) wingspan, 72.75” (185 cm) long and 58.25” (148 cm) wide. Notions 1 stitch marker, tapestry needle, blocking tools.

The entrelacs are 8 stitches wide, but you can just as easily make them 6 or 7 for a narrower scarf. Alternately, instead of 3 entrelacs you could do 2 wider ones. Something I did for this design which is atypical of entrelac, is to add two stitches of garter stitch on each end. This makes a nice edge for the increases and decreases, and finishes it of nicely.

Myrrine sweater is worked seamlessly in the round, from the bottom up to the armholes. The body and sleeves are worked separately. Some short rows are added to the back of the sweater for a better fit, before joining body and sleeves for working the yoke to the neck edge. After last decrease round in the yoke, some short rows are added again across the back of the neck, to raise it higher than the front for the proper fit of the garment. The sweater is intended to be worn with approximately 10.25 cm / 4” positive ease, however the sleeves are relatively skinny, to counterbalance the loosely fitted body. Don’t forget, you can knit the body and sleeves to desired length, or decrease some stitches at the neck edge (before knitting the neckband) for a narrower neckline to your taste. Desert is the perfect timeless sweater. Work in a beautiful fingering weight yarn, with simple cable texture and a small v-neck that results in a flattering and modern silhouette. It is worked seamlessly from the top-down with a cable stitch pattern throughout. Start working the back and shape the back neck with short rows. Continue to work the back until the length of the armhole. Pick up the stitches for the front and work both fronts symmetrically until the length of the armhole. Join back and fronts to work the body in cable pattern down to the bottom ribbing. Pick up the sleeve sts to work the sleeves in rounds in cable pattern.
